01

Snapshot

Quantum Machines was founded in 2018 by Dr. Itamar Sivan, Dr. Yonatan Cohen, and Dr. Nissim Ofek, three physicists who met at the Weizmann Institute of Science. Headquartered in Tel Aviv, the company operates privately and has raised over $100M to date, including a $50M Series B in September 2021. In 2022, the company completed its first acquisition, purchasing the Danish quantum technology firm QDevil.

02

Core Activity

Quantum Machines does not build quantum processors (qubits). Instead, it focuses entirely on the control and orchestration layer that sits between classical computers and quantum hardware. The system utilizes FPGAs to generate precise electromagnetic pulses and measure qubit states with ultra-low latency. Customers consist of academic research labs, national laboratories, and commercial enterprises building full-stack quantum computers.

03

Products & Services

The company's flagship hardware line is the OPX (and OPX+) series, which are rack-mounted quantum control systems (QCS) providing multi-channel pulse generation and measurement. On the software side, Quantum Machines developed QUA, a pulse-level programming language that allows physicists to write complex quantum algorithms and compile them directly into hardware instructions. Through the QDevil acquisition, the company also offers auxiliary electronics and cryogenic filters used inside dilution refrigerators.

04

Market Position

In the quantum control layer, the company competes primarily with established test-and-measurement companies that have built specific quantum divisions, such as Zurich Instruments (now part of Rohde & Schwarz) and Keysight Technologies. The platform is intentionally hardware-agnostic, interfacing with multiple qubit modalities including superconducting, trapped ion, and neutral atom architectures.

05

Israel Presence

The company's Tel Aviv headquarters houses the bulk of its R&D. The engineering organization requires highly specific talent profiles, extensively recruiting PhD physicists, FPGA engineers, and embedded developers in Israel. In a major local milestone, Quantum Machines was selected in 2022 by the Israel Innovation Authority to establish and manage the Israeli National Quantum Computing Center, working alongside Elbit Systems and other partners.
